The Best Link-in-Bio Tools for Instagram in 2026

Bio link tools ranked for Instagram-first creators. Covers AutoDM features, in-app aesthetics, and mobile load times on iOS and Android.

Instagram is where the bio link was born. The single-link rule in the profile field created the whole category, and any tool you pick lives or dies by how it looks when opened inside the Instagram in-app browser. That's a specific constraint: the browser renders slightly differently than Safari or Chrome, the viewer is almost always on a phone, and they scrolled into your page from a reel or story so their attention is short. This ranking focuses on tools that perform well in that exact context, including the ones that offer Instagram AutoDM, a feature that drives real conversion when you do it right.

What to look for

For Instagram specifically, four things matter more than they do in general bio link rankings. First, mobile load time, because the in-app browser is slower than a native mobile Safari session and a heavy page drops viewers before the first paint. Second, visual density. Instagram viewers skim; a page that loads fast but looks cluttered loses them anyway. Third, AutoDM or keyword-triggered DM features, which let a comment on a reel automatically generate a DM with a link. This is the single highest-ROI Instagram growth feature most creators don't use yet. Fourth, Instagram content embeds (latest posts, reels grid, story highlights) that turn the bio page into a content hub instead of just a link wall.

How we picked

Judged on four axes: mobile load time in the Instagram in-app browser, visual polish specifically when rendered on iPhone 15 and Pixel 8, AutoDM or Instagram-automation support, and Instagram content embed quality (posts, reels, highlights).

Methodology

We opened each shortlisted tool's demo page inside the Instagram app on iOS 17 and Android 14, timed the first meaningful paint, and evaluated layout. For AutoDM features, we tested the actual comment-to-DM flow on an Instagram Business account. Fee and feature details were cross-checked against pricing pages as of April 2026.

Winner

Stan Store
stan.store

Stan Store wins for Instagram because it's the only tool in this list built mobile-first by design rather than adapted for mobile. The AutoDM feature alone is worth the $29/mo for creators with any real Instagram engagement: a comment on a reel triggers an automatic DM to the commenter with a product link, and conversion rates on that flow are 5-15% higher than sending them to a bio link. The mobile checkout is also the most polished in the category. The reason this isn't the default recommendation for everyone is the price, but for Instagram-first creators who sell anything, it pays back fast.

Strengths
  • AutoDM on Instagram converts meaningfully better than a bio-link click
  • Mobile checkout is the most polished in the category
  • Flat $29/mo replaces bio-link, checkout, and community tools
  • Built mobile-first, not adapted from a desktop design
Weaknesses
  • No free tier, only a 14-day trial
  • Steep starting price for creators not yet monetizing
  • Design flexibility narrower than Beacons or Bio.fm

Also worth considering

2
Beaconsbeacons.ai

Beacons is the pick if you want strong Instagram features without paying $29/mo to start. Creator Pro at $10/mo includes similar Instagram automation tooling and the pages look modern when rendered in the IG in-app browser. For creators who haven't committed to monetizing yet or want to test the bio link channel before upgrading, Beacons hits the right point on the price-to-feature curve.

Strengths
  • Instagram automation features on Creator Pro at $10/mo
  • Free tier works well as an entry point
  • Pages render fast in the Instagram in-app browser
  • Media kit feature useful for brand-deal conversations
Weaknesses
  • AutoDM implementation is less mature than Stan Store's
  • Branding removal requires $90/mo Business Pro tier
3
Linktreelinktr.ee

Linktree is the default Instagram bio link because Instagram users recognize it instantly. That recognition is a real asset for brands where viewers might hesitate to click an unknown URL. The tradeoff is the page looks like every other Linktree page, and the commerce fees are rough if you sell anything. Pick it if brand recognition outweighs design distinctiveness for your audience.

Strengths
  • Instant recognition from Instagram viewers
  • Stable, fast-loading pages in the IG in-app browser
  • Large integration ecosystem including IG-specific embeds
Weaknesses
  • Generic-looking pages undermine creator brand distinctiveness
  • 9-12% commerce fees on anything but the $35 Premium tier
  • No native AutoDM equivalent
4
Milkshakemilkshake.app

Milkshake is the Instagram-native pick for creators whose whole workflow lives on their phone. It's built like a tiny magazine rather than a link list, and the card-based layout feels at home next to an Instagram grid. The phone-only editor is a constraint that works for Instagram-first creators because they're already editing and posting from mobile. For anyone who works from a laptop, it's a hard pass.

Strengths
  • Phone-native editor matches the Instagram workflow
  • Card layouts look editorial, not template-y
  • Cheap paid tiers (under $7/mo)
Weaknesses
  • No web or desktop editor, at all
  • Weaker analytics than Beacons or Linktree
  • Smaller feature set for non-design use cases
5
Bio.fmbio.fm

Bio.fm is worth mentioning specifically for the automatic latest-9-Instagram-posts embed, which turns the bio page into a live extension of the grid. The one-time $24.99 Unique plan is a reasonable call for Instagram creators who know they want a bio page forever and don't want another subscription. Design polish trails the newer entrants.

Strengths
  • Automatic latest-Instagram-posts embed
  • One-time payment option for lifetime access
  • Rich media embeds for reels and video
Weaknesses
  • No Instagram AutoDM feature
  • Design feels dated next to newer tools

FAQ

Does Instagram penalize bio links from specific tools?

No. Instagram treats all bio link URLs the same for display and crawling. Any ranking claims that say otherwise are marketing. What Instagram does penalize is redirects that go through suspicious short-URL services, so stick to the major bio link platforms.

Is AutoDM worth it for small accounts?

Yes, starting around 1,000 engaged followers. The math is: a reel that gets 50 comments, 40% of which trigger an AutoDM with a link, converts substantially better than those same 50 people hunting for a bio link manually. Below 500 followers, the feature is overkill.

Why does load time matter so much on Instagram?

The Instagram in-app browser is meaningfully slower than Safari or Chrome, and bio link traffic is almost all mobile. If your page takes more than 2-3 seconds to first paint, you lose a significant percentage of viewers before they see anything. All tools on this list are within acceptable range, but heavier pages (lots of embeds, custom fonts, video) can cross the threshold.

Should I use a custom domain on my Instagram bio?

If you're a brand, yes. yourname.com looks meaningfully more professional than yourname.bio.link, and Instagram viewers who click-through are more likely to convert. Expect to pay $5-15/mo extra for this feature on any major platform.

Do Instagram's link sticker and bio link compete?

Yes, and the link sticker often wins for story traffic. But the bio link is still the home base and is where most profile visitors land. Use both: stories for timely campaigns, bio link for evergreen.
